Extension: UHarc Compressed Archive

Developer: UHarc

The .uha file extension signifies a compressed archive created using the UHarc compression utility. This format employs a sophisticated dual-compression method, combining the power of LZMA (Lempel-Ziv-Markov chain-Algorithm) and Huffman coding. LZMA excels at compressing repetitive data patterns, while Huffman coding optimizes the storage of frequently occurring data elements. This synergistic approach results in significantly smaller file sizes compared to simpler compression techniques, making it ideal for archiving large amounts of data like images, videos, or software installations. However, because of its specialized nature, it’s not as universally supported as more common formats like ZIP or RAR. Keep in mind that the high compression ratio achieved by UHA sometimes comes at the cost of slightly slower compression speeds compared to other methods.

Opening a .uha file requires a compatible program capable of understanding and decompressing the UHarc format. While some archive managers might offer support, dedicated UHarc decompression software is usually needed for reliable extraction. Searching online for “UHarc” will yield various resources, including standalone decompression tools and potentially plugins for existing archive managers. Before downloading any software, ensure you obtain it from a trusted and reputable source to avoid malware. Once you have the appropriate software installed, opening the .uha file is typically a straightforward process, often involving double-clicking the file or using the software’s “open” or “extract” function to access the contents within. Remember to always scan extracted files with antivirus software as a precautionary measure.
